Choosing the Right Size



When picking the suitable Skip container dimension for your requirements, it's vital to consider the amount of waste you expect to throw away. Selecting bin removal that's as well small can result in overflow, while opting for one that's too huge might cause unneeded prices. Beginning by approximating the quantity of waste you prepare for generating.

For tiny family clean-ups or improvements, a 2 to 4 cubic meter Skip container could be enough. If you're taking on larger tasks like significant remodellings or landscaping, you may call for a 6 to 8 cubic meter bin. For substantial commercial undertakings, take into consideration a 10 to 12 cubic meter Skip bin.

It's better to somewhat overestimate your needs to prevent any kind of last-minute troubles. Keep in mind, it's important to load the Skip bin securely and uniformly to avoid any type of issues throughout transport and disposal. Understanding Waste Disposal Regulations



To make sure an effective waste disposal process, it's critical to familiarize on your own with waste disposal policies that regulate the proper handling and disposal of various sorts of waste products. Different kinds of waste require specific disposal methods to protect the setting and public health. Contaminated materials, as an example, need to be handled with extreme caution and disposed of complying with strict standards to avoid contamination.

Prior to leasing an avoid container, take the time to research and understand the waste disposal guidelines in your location. Communities usually have regulations concerning what can and can not be thrown away in Skip bins. Mixing prohibited things with general waste can result in fines or various other charges.

Some common banned products consist of unsafe products, electronic devices, batteries, and chemicals.

Making Best Use Of Performance and Cost-Effectiveness



To maximize effectiveness and cost-effectiveness when leasing Skip containers, it's necessary to very carefully evaluate your garbage disposal requirements and select the right bin dimension for the task. By properly estimating the amount of waste you require to take care of, you can stay clear of renting out a container that's too huge or too little, which can cause unneeded expenditures or multiple trips.



Selecting a bin that's a little larger than your approximated needs can aid avoid overflows and service charges for exceeding weight limits.

In addition, consider segregating your waste to maximize the Skip bin area. Sorting materials like steel, wood, cardboard, and basic waste can help optimize the bin's capability and potentially minimize costs by permitting reusing or proper disposal of certain products.

In addition, condensing waste as much as possible before putting it in the Skip bin can help you take advantage of the room available. Breaking down huge things and squashing boxes can produce more space for added waste, conserving you cash on leasing several bins. By being mindful of these techniques, you can efficiently manage your garbage disposal requires while keeping expenses in check.
